**09:48** — Dedup job for Cordavale customer records flagged 18k false merges. Root cause: the Mergewell matcher treated empty middle-name fields as equal, collapsing unrelated accounts. Halted the pipeline at 09:55, restored merged records from the pre-run snapshot by 11:20. Matcher now requires at least two non-empty corroborating fields. Follow-up: add a dry-run diff gate before any bulk merge. The matcher build that produced the bad merges is identified below.

pipeline stamp: htk21_104c5ba7d0df6b2897cd5

Visitors do not enter the spare-hardware room. No exceptions. If a guest needs a loaner headset or cable, call the duty technician and wait at the desk. Do not lend your badge. Do not prop the door. All removals go in the logbook, even five-minute borrows. Escorted contractors from Brindlecote Maintenance may enter only with a work order on file. Reception staff covering the evening rota can open the door using the code below.

door code, yagap-bahof: bdg-O-05

Visiting contractors at the Halloway Point campus should note that the first-aid room on the ground floor, beside the Fernlea stairwell, remains locked outside staffed hours for the security of supplies. In any urgent situation, contractors may enter directly using the standing access code, which is provided immediately below.

turnstile pass: bdg-YPPQB-52010

Hello plugin authors,

Next Thursday, Corbexa will run a disaster-recovery drill for the RestockRoute vending-machine restock planner. During the failover window, plugin callbacks will be replayed against the standby scheduler, so please ensure your handlers are idempotent and tolerate duplicate route assignments. No customer restock data will be altered. To re-register your plugin against the standby environment during the drill, authenticate with the recovery passphrase provided below.

vault phrase of hahip-tajeg = quenax-briath-briax